It sounds harder than it is because of all the ghost notes on both snare and bass drum. Take a look around for some live versions and you'll get a better idea of how Alan White played it. Not that it matters but he always played with his left hand on the hats and his right on the snare. Nearly every Oasis sound he did uses a variation of the same technique. Lots of ghosts notes and triplets. You can achieve a similiar sound with brushes or rods. But, try some live versions where he used sticks.

To drumkid12345, I don't know if you practice single or double rolls but practising double stroke rolls RRLLRRLL will make the song much easier as he uses a lot of quiet drags.
